The head of the Ministry of Economy and Finance (MEF), Alex Contreras, pointed out, during the conference held this Thursday, November 9, that as a second measure of Impulso Mi Perú, a change will be made to the new agrarian law and will promote reforms to improve the agricultural sector.
In that sense, he indicated that among the measures that will be carried out is the expansion of agricultural insurance in the event of the El Niño Phenomenon, a bill that allows dar incentives for hiring in the agricultural sector, and strengthen regulatory entities such as Sanipes and Digesa. In addition, a financing incentive will be given to small agricultural producers.
“Unfortunately, the repeal of the agrarian promotion law generated structural damage to the agro-export sector. So we need to recover our ability to reach external markets competitively, That is why we are going to propose some regulatory changes to the law of the agro-export sector.“said Contreras.
